United Kingdom · Information Technology & Services
Information Technology & Services
Software Development
Enterprise Software
Since 1987 QBS Software have delivered software to over 240,000 organisations around the world through their reseller of choice. We provide a range of over 10,000 software publishers and offer a fast, reliable and responsive service. More than 6000 resellers have partnered with QBS in 2021
1987
Founded
Information Technology & Services
Industry
United Kingdom
Location
67,715
Ranking
200 employees
Size

Get full access to view complete information
